   * Copy a page from "oldmem". For this page, there is no pte mapped
   * in the current kernel. We stitch up a pte, similar to kmap_atomic.
   */
  ssize_t copy_oldmem_page(unsigned long pfn, char *buf,
  				size_t csize, unsigned long offset, int userbuf)
  {
  	void *page, *vaddr;
  
  	if (!csize)
  		return 0;
  
  	page = kmalloc(PAGE_SIZE, GFP_KERNEL);
  	if (!page)
  		return -ENOMEM;
  
  	vaddr = kmap_atomic_pfn(pfn, KM_PTE0);
  	copy_page(page, vaddr);
  	kunmap_atomic(vaddr, KM_PTE0);
  
  	if (userbuf) {
  		if (copy_to_user(buf, (page + offset), csize)) {
  			kfree(page);
  			return -EFAULT;
  		}
  	} else {
  		memcpy(buf, (page + offset), csize);
  	}
  
  	kfree(page);
  	return csize;
  }
